Edward E. Jones

Edward E. Jones was a prominent American social psychologist known for his research on how people form impressions of others and make judgments. He explored how personal experiences, cognitive biases, and social cues influence perception and behavior. His work contributed to understanding attribution theory—how individuals explain the causes of behavior—and emphasized the importance of context and individual differences. Jones's insights help explain everyday social interactions, decision-making, and the sometimes flawed nature of human judgment, making his contributions valuable in psychology, marketing, and understanding social dynamics.
